Shannon Elizabeth, the actress who charmed audiences as Nadia in the iconic American Pie, is making waves with a fresh career move. After saying goodbye to her Hollywood career, Elizabeth is stepping into the world of OnlyFans, striving to shape her own narrative and engage with her audience more personally.
At 52, Shannon Elizabeth has seen a full spectrum of fame, particularly after her memorable appearance in American Pie. Reflecting on her journey, she acknowledges how pivotal that role was, candidly stating she might not have sustained a career without it. Her transition away from acting was largely influenced by her commitment to her conservation charity, but she's ready for a new chapter.
“I really do think this is the future,” Elizabeth shared, expressing her optimism about the potential OnlyFans holds for personal freedom and creative control.
Joining OnlyFans on April 16, Elizabeth is eager to show fans a side of herself they haven't seen, focusing on a more sensual portrayal that breaks free from Hollywood's constraints. This platform, she believes, offers her the flexibility to connect with fans on her terms, which marks a stark contrast to her previous experiences in the film industry.
Elizabeth has always been open about her on-screen nudity, yet she emphasizes that her real-life persona is far more reserved. This venture is about reclaiming her image and steering it in a direction she feels comfortable with, distinct from her former roles.
Shannon Elizabeth isn't alone in this digital pivot. Celebrities like Lily Allen, Jessie Cave, Drea De Matteo, Cardi B, and Bella Thorne have also found a home on OnlyFans.
